Experiment II A sample space contains seven simpleevents: E 1 , E 2 , ... , E 7 . Suppose that E 1 , E 2 , ... , E 6 allhave the same probability , but E 7 is twice as likely asthe others.Find the probabilities of the events inExercises 7−10. 9. C = { E 2 , E 4 }

Definition Definition For any random event or experiment, the set that is formed with all the possible outcomes is called a sample space. When any random event takes place that has multiple outcomes, the possible outcomes are grouped together in a set. The sample space can be anything, from a set of vectors to real numbers.
